Output e488578e50b0608ee3112081467ef7e91dce17b0b7600fbc1caabdad21971825:3

value
63300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5387dc69d9fe327f79b6b42440c4bd6c45ebfee8 OP_EQUAL
address
39JgmFcZLEDVLsmVJaAwbKHLco2e5dgHVi
transaction
e488578e50b0608ee3112081467ef7e91dce17b0b7600fbc1caabdad21971825
spent
true